Big Brother Hotshots Housemates Chastised!


Being one of the fans of the Africa's Reality Show, Big Brother Africa, I cannot but talk about the show once in a while. This year's show, captioned Big Brother Africa Hotshots, had a total of twenty-six housemates from thirteen African countries, two from each, living in one house. Housemates get evicted every Sunday. This is the sixth week, with only fourteen housemates still in the show.


The fourteen housemates, this evening, got the shock of their lives when they were terribly scolded by the voice they all recognized and fondly called 'Big Brother' or 'Biggie'. They were chastised for their lack of keeping the house neat. Amidst shame, shock and giggles, they ran helter-skelter to put the house in order when it dawned on them that Biggie was not going to stop until they obeyed.

Here are some of the things Biggie said;
"What kind of housemates are these? Is this how you live in your houses? How do you expect Africa to vote for you when you are lazy to keep your environment clean? I am disappointed in you. Why are you disgracing your countries like this? At the end of the day, you expect to be congratulated and given Three Hundred Thousand US Dollars for being the last person standing. For what? For eating and drinking and being lazy?"
In most cases, referring directly to the housemates from Zimbabwe and South Africa, JJ and Nhlanhla, respectively.
